Graham was a believer in using a low price-to-book-value (P/B) ratio to select stocks and normally requires a ratio below 1.5 for the defensive investor. However ... There is a well-tested, disciplined value-investing approach used in analyzing stocks, one taught by Benjamin Graham at Columbia, and practiced by his star student, Warren Buffett.In principal, the value investing strategy relies on finding undervalued companies, buying shares and then making money when the market corrects and these previously undervalued companies go up in price. In this way, the strategy is looking for inefficiencies in the marketplace and taking advantage of what the general market sentiment is.

For example, if the true value of a share (as per your calculations) is Rs 200, however, it is currently trading at Rs 120. Then the stock is undervalued.
